Six pulled the door inward and hurried into the room, zig-zagging between the pedestals and barstools and jumping onto couches, and throwing herself on the wine-red cushions, laughing and giggling. Mono felt himself grinning, and now his feet moved on their own, taking him past the pool table and through brick walls littered with posters. He spun around as he walked beneath the bar shelves behind the counter, taking in the scenery about him. He climbed up the drawers and made it to the top of the bar table. He walked across it, passing trays filled with ash and crumpled cigarettes, empty glass cups, and bottles tumbled over bottles with a faint smell of liqueur still lingering from the rims. He hopped over the stains and sat along the edge of the table, and looked around. Six was down there on the cushions, laying on her back with her arms and legs outstretched, Mono waved at her, and she waved back, smiling. 

He could see everything from up here, and it was truly a work of art as if this were a slice from heaven, the world that came before them was really something else. If its remnants were that beautiful, Mono could only imagine how it all could've looked like before everything went downhill. Doubtless, it would've been a sight to behold. 

Mono looked around a bit more and saw a bunch of machines, with posters of a person in a spacesuit shooting meteors with a funny-looking laser gun. The one on its left had a poster of a policeman with the words, Shoot To Kill, written above him. Arcade games... Mono realized. He'd never thought he'd see another one of those any time soon. Too bad all of them were out of order...

"Mono!" Six cried, "Look!" 

Mono glanced down and saw Six standing beside a giant machine. He took a closer look and found that it was a vending machine. It had rows and rows of all kinds of snacks, chips, chocolate, soda cans, cookies, and fluffy cakes. Mono stood up, excitement taking over him. He hopped down and landed on the seat of the barstool, then jumped off and made it to the ground with a soft thud.

Oh, man... this place just keeps on giving. If it were up to him, he'd never want to leave this place, ever. Six beckoned to him, "Come on!" She said, pressing her hands against the glass. Mono stood next to her and looked up at the machine. "How does this thing work?" She said, tearing her gaze away from it to look back at Mono.

Mono scratched his chin, musing. It had power, no doubt about that. He could hear the faint humming of its motor... but they had money on them. "Uhh, gimmie a sec," Mono said and went to examine the machine further. Six stood there watching him curiously. He looked under the machine and behind it and came back empty-handed. "Well, I guess that leaves only one choice..." He said, moving towards the take-out port. He pushed it open and slipped a glance inside. "HA!"

"What are you doing?" Six asked.

Mono looked back at her and grinned, "Here's one of many advantages of being tiny. Wait here." He said and pushed the plastic shutter all the way and crawled inside. It got so chilly in here that Mono started shivering. It took him a few tries to reach the top, as the metal was slippery, and he had nowhere to hook his fingers nor a place to steady himself with his legs. 

"Are you alright in there?" Six asked.

"Just dandy! Look up!" He said, waving at her from beyond the glass. Six looked up, covering her eyes from the light coming from the machine, and waved back, smiling. "What do you like to eat?" He asked her.

Six put a finger to her lip, eyes darting up and down, then left and right. Then pointed at the yellow bag of chips up there on the higher shelves, "This one..." She said.

Mono nodded and started to climb. It was easier now that there were edges and gaps to hang on to. Mono made his way to the top and walked slowly across the narrow path to reach the bag of chips. He then ripped it out of the iron coils and dropped it down into the take-out port. "Special delivery!" Mono cried.

Six reached inside the take-out port and took the chips. Fumbling with it for a while, trying to figure out how to get it open.

"Want anything else with it?" Mono asked, dropping down the shelves.

Six looked up again and thought for a moment, "This...?" She said, pointing at a bottle of soda.

"You got it!" Mono said and went to work, carefully making his way down and through the shelves. He then wrenched the soda from the iron hooks and dropped it down, "Hey, Six. Give that thing some time. don't open it straight away." 

"Why?" she asked as she reached in and picked it from the port.

"Trust me, just don't." He said, going back to look around for something he likes. He chose a bag of cheese-flavored chips, a chocolate bar about his size, a pack of jelly beans, and a fluffy cake. He tossed them all down the take-out port and jumped down himself, landing softly against them. Mono pushed open the lid and crawled out of the vending machine. He saw Six sitting there cross-legged, still struggling to get the bag open all the way. 

He took out the snacks and splayed them on the floor beside her. He then found the nearest spot next to her and sunk to the floor. "Here, let me help with that." Mono offered a hand.

"I got it..." Six said and gnawed the bag open. She spat out the piece of plastic to the other side and hooked her fingers between the gaps, and opened it. "There..." she said.

Mono thought he might as well join her, so he grabbed his cheese-flavored chips and mimicked her actions, biting the bag and ripping out the plastic with his teeth. 

Six took her first bite and was totally taken aback, so crunchy and weird... for a moment, she stopped chewing and looked at Mono, "Salty..." She said.

"Is it no good?" Mono asked, feeling perturbed all of a sudden.

"It's delicious..." She said, swallowing and taking another bite. 

Mono looked down at his own bag of chips, the fragrance of cheese filling his nostrils. He lifted his paper bag, took out a piece, and bit it. He felt the sour taste of salt and cheese coating his mouth. "Delicious!" He said with his mouth full. But then the trouble came when he tried to swallow. The piece felt like nails scraping against his throat. He rubbed the scar around his neck, soothing the pain as he forced down the food. Perhaps something softer would do... the cake.

And so they sat there, enjoying the snacks together. Mono left his bag of chips for Six if she wanted more. He would also offer her a piece of cake. In return, she would hold out her chips bag for him, but Mono would only wave a hand.

 After eating half the cake, Mono glanced at the chocolate bar. There's no way I could eat that, he thought. But he really wanted to have a taste, despite the pain in his throat. Maybe... if he broke into tiny bits. So he grabbed the bar and ripped its sheets with his teeth and went to work, seizing it by its torn edges and digging his fingers in between them until he reached the biscuit. With great effort, the pieces snapped apart, "There..." He muttered as he repeated the process. He kept on going until the chocolate could fit his hand.

Six turned from her bag of chips and watched him, "What are you doing?" She asked.

"You'll see, give me a sec," Mono said, tearing off the pieces and sizing them into bits. "Alright, come over here." He beckoned to her.

Six moved and sat on her knees next to him, "What's this?"

 "Here, give me your hand..." He said. Six placed her hand in his. He opened her palm and gave her a handful of chocolate, "This... this is special. you'll love it... go on, have a taste."

As she ate the tiny bits of chocolate, her face twisted with delight. "It's so good! It tastes like... like..." Six kept asking for more and more. Mono felt himself giggling, and so he gave her another handful and sat back, "You have some too!"Six said.

"Uhh, yeah. In a moment." Mono looked at the chocolate pieces in his hand. He was quite reluctant to eat them, but they were broken into tiny bits, so that shouldn't be a problem... right? Mono rubbed the scar on his neck again, then ate one of the pieces. Ah...! So sweet! Mono guess the word Six was looking for was it tastes like heaven. 

Now came the hard part, but soon he found that it wasn't so hard, after all. They went down rather easily. Good... he always wanted to taste chocolate again, at least one more time. And so they ate and ate until they could eat no more. 

Six felt her throat dry up after mixing both sweet and sour together, "I'm thirsty." She said, looking around for the bottle of soda, and found it laying there sideways next to the bag of chips, "Can I open that now?" Six asked, pointing at the bottle. 

"Yes." He said only. 

Six hopped on her feet and made for the bottle, she examined it for a bit, seeing tiny bubbles floating upwards and popping at the very top. "Are you sure this is not poison? It looks... bubbly..." 

"No, it's meant to be bubbly... it's safe, trust me." Mono said.

Six lightly tapped on the bottle and saw a flurry of bubbles rising from the bottom, she found that amusing, and did it again. More and more bubbles floated from top to bottom, "Hey Mono. Look at this." She said flicking the bottle with her finger, making the bubbles flow. Mono sighed, Is she gonna drink it or not? 

Then she started shaking the bottle up and down, "Hey! Hey wait! Don't just shake it like that!" Mono snapped. 

"Why not?! It's fun..." 

 "Ah-" You know what? Just let it happen... "Nevermind... do as you like." Mono said, shrugging.

Six placed the bottle side ways again and tilted it slightly upwards. She grabbed the lid and started twisting it, she made tiny grunting sounds as she struggled to get it open, "Mono... can you give me a hand? I can't seem to..." The lid finally twisted open, "Oh nevermind I got-" the lid suddenly bursted open smacking Six in the face and sending her flying across the room, she softly landed against the cushions, she sat there wide eyed drenched with all over with soda, tiny pints fell from the edge of her hair and on to her clothes. 

Mono guffawed, clutching his sides as his laughter echoed around the bar, he laughed so hard that his throat and chest started to hurt, but he laughed all the same. "I can't even!" He said and rolled on the floor. 

Six stared at him, her features stern and humorless. her lips made a straight line as she stood up and lifted the edge of her blue sweater and coiled it above her midriff and wrung the water out of it. Mono was still laughing there, until he saw her starting at him, unamuzed. His laughter became nervous, then fell short. "Aw come on, it was just a bit of fun!" 

Six reached with her hand and pushed back the wet hair from her face. He saw her face, blushing and scowling.

"I... Uhhh." I should not have done that.

He heard a faint snorting noise, Six could no longer keep a straight face, her lips trembled and she bursted into laughter herself, that's very much the second time he'd seen her laugh like this.
